## What is the Network of Oracle Network Monitoring?

Oracle Network Monitoring, within the context of cryptocurrency, options trading, and financial derivatives, represents a critical layer of infrastructure ensuring data integrity and reliability for decentralized applications and trading platforms. It bridges the gap between off-chain real-world data and on-chain smart contracts, providing verifiable and tamper-proof information feeds essential for accurate pricing, settlement, and risk management. The increasing complexity of crypto derivatives necessitates robust monitoring systems to detect anomalies, validate data sources, and maintain the operational stability of these interconnected ecosystems.

## What is the Oracle of Oracle Network Monitoring?

The term "oracle" itself denotes an external data source that feeds information into a blockchain or smart contract. In this specialized context, an oracle network comprises a distributed set of independent data providers, each contributing to a consensus-driven data feed. This redundancy mitigates the risk of single points of failure and enhances the trustworthiness of the information used in decentralized financial (DeFi) protocols and derivative exchanges. Sophisticated oracle networks employ cryptographic techniques and economic incentives to ensure data accuracy and prevent malicious manipulation.

## What is the Monitoring of Oracle Network Monitoring?

Effective Oracle Network Monitoring involves continuous assessment of data quality, latency, and the overall health of the oracle infrastructure. This includes tracking metrics such as data source reputation, consensus mechanisms, and the responsiveness of individual oracle nodes. Advanced monitoring systems leverage machine learning algorithms to identify unusual patterns, detect potential attacks, and proactively address vulnerabilities within the oracle network, safeguarding the integrity of derivative pricing and trading activities.
